Briggs & Stratton Intec I/C 875 Series Specifications

General IconGeneral
Compression Ratio8.5:1
Governor TypeMechanical
Lubrication SystemSplash
Engine Type4-Stroke OHV
Starting SystemRecoil
Fuel TypeGasoline
CarburetorFloat-type
Cooling SystemAir Cooled
Rotation DirectionCounterclockwise (from PTO side)
